PHP Laravel:更新一对多关系

时间:2016-01-16 10:30:41

标签: php laravel eloquent one-to-many

我的Eloquent模型中有一对多的关系,并且想知道更新模型的最佳方法,尤其是belongsTo模型部分。

我遇到过其他答案,这些答案表明我确实单独保存了每个belongsTo模型,但这会带来一个问题,因为我将对数据库服务器进行n次调用,而不是单个插入或少数。

所以我想知道确保我的查询和数据库资源得到优化和有效的最佳方法。

1 个答案:

答案 0 :(得分:0)

hasOne / hasMany(1-1,1-M)     1.保存(新的或现有的)     2. saveMany(新模型或现有模型数组)

使用这两种方法中的任何一种......